Growing up in Harlem, Sean Combs was exposed to the vibrant culture and music scene of New York City. He attended Howard University, where he initially pursued a degree in business administration but left to focus on his burgeoning music career. Combs began as an intern at Uptown Records, quickly rising through the ranks to become a talent director. His early work with artists like Mary J. Blige and Jodeci laid the foundation for his future success.

In 2009, P Diddy announced the formation of a new musical group, Dirty Money, alongside singers Dawn Richard and Kalenna Harper. This collaboration aimed to create a fresh sound that combined elements of hip-hop, R&B, and dance music. The trio quickly gained attention for their unique style and dynamic performances, setting the stage for their debut album, "Last Train to Paris."
